One of the best ways to capture stunning pictures is to focus on natural moments rather than forced poses. I find that encouraging playful interactions or candid expressions brings out the genuine beauty and personality of the subject.
Using natural light can make a huge difference in your photos. Shooting near windows or outdoors during golden hour helps create soft and flattering lighting that enhances details and colors. Avoid harsh midday sun as it may cast unwanted shadows.
Experimenting with different angles and perspectives can add variety and interest to your images. Try shooting from a slightly lower position or capturing close-ups to highlight unique features and expressions.
Lastly, patience and persistence are key. Sometimes the perfect shot happens in an unexpected moment, so keeping your camera ready and maintaining a relaxed atmosphere helps ensure you don’t miss it.
